How to Find Reliable Free Forex Signals Online

Forex trading is a highly lucrative market, but it can also be overwhelming and risky for beginners. That’s where forex signals come in. Forex signals are recommendations or alerts that suggest potential trades based on technical analysis. These signals can help traders make informed decisions and increase their chances of success in the forex market. While there are many paid forex signal services available, finding reliable free forex signals online can be a challenge. In this article, we will discuss how to find reliable free forex signals online.

1. Research and Compare Signal Providers:

The first step in finding reliable free forex signals is to research and compare different signal providers. Look for providers that have a good reputation and positive reviews from other traders. It’s essential to ensure that the signal provider is credible and has a track record of successful signals. Additionally, compare the signals provided by different providers to see if they align with your trading strategy and goals.

600x600

2. Consider the Source:

When searching for free forex signals online, it’s crucial to consider the source of the signals. Look for signals provided by reputable forex websites, experienced traders, or professional forex analysts. Avoid signals from unknown or unverified sources, as they may not be reliable or accurate. It’s also worth checking if the signal provider has any affiliations with brokers or financial institutions, as this could affect the objectivity of the signals.

3. Evaluate the Signal Quality:

To ensure reliability, it’s essential to evaluate the quality of the signals provided. Look for signals that come with detailed analysis, entry and exit points, stop-loss and take-profit levels, and risk management strategies. Reliable signals should be clear, concise, and based on sound technical analysis. Avoid signals that are vague or lack proper justification, as they may lead to poor trading decisions.

4. Consider the Frequency and Timing:

Another factor to consider when looking for reliable free forex signals is the frequency and timing of the signals. Ideally, you want signals that are provided in real-time or with minimal delay to take advantage of market opportunities. Signals that are too infrequent or delayed may not be practical for active traders. Additionally, consider the time zone of the signal provider to ensure that the signals align with your trading hours.

5. Use Multiple Signal Providers:

To increase the reliability of free forex signals, it’s beneficial to use multiple signal providers. This way, you can compare signals from different sources and identify any consistent patterns or trends. Using multiple signal providers also helps to mitigate the risk of relying on a single source, as signals can sometimes be inaccurate or misleading. However, it’s important to avoid overwhelming yourself with too many signals, as this can lead to confusion and indecision.

6. Demo Testing:

Before implementing any forex signals into your live trading account, it’s crucial to test them in a demo account. Demo testing allows you to evaluate the accuracy and effectiveness of the signals without risking real money. It also gives you an opportunity to understand how the signals work and how they align with your trading strategy. If the signals consistently produce positive results in a demo account, you can consider implementing them in your live trading.

7. Stay Informed and Educated:

While relying on free forex signals can be helpful, it’s essential to stay informed and educated about the forex market. Develop your trading skills, learn about different technical indicators, and understand the fundamentals that drive the market. This knowledge will enable you to make better decisions and validate the signals provided by signal providers. Being an informed trader will also help you identify unreliable or misleading signals.

In conclusion, finding reliable free forex signals online requires thorough research, evaluation, and testing. Consider the reputation and credibility of the signal provider, the quality and timing of the signals, and the need for demo testing. By using multiple signal providers and staying informed and educated, you can increase your chances of finding reliable free forex signals that align with your trading strategy and goals. Remember, while forex signals can be valuable tools, they should not be the sole basis for your trading decisions.
